Andrew Sharman, RMS Switzerland

 

Andrew is founder of RMS, a global consultancy specialising in culture and leadership with a client base typically comprised of Fortune 500 and FTSE 100 Organisations, spanning a range of industry sectors and countries.

 

Andrew is Immediate Past President of IOSH and Chairman of the Institute of Leadership & Management. Andrew teaches at some of the world’s most prestigious business schools and is Professor of Leadership & Safety Culture and Program Director at CEDEP - the European Centre for Executive Development; teaches at the California Institute of Technology, and speaks on post-graduate programmes at the University of Zurich.

 

Andrew is the author of nine books on safety culture, leadership and wellbeing.  His first book From Accidents to Zero is the world’s best-selling book on safety culture with over 84,000 copies sold.
